Output c3fab11072155359f7fd77ee70c8317550727613c6246070c3467333f60f5e33:40

value
28777450
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 88481c6d918cab33a8f7e55e64793f3e633f9c4a8f4e96d072c6c28eacc9a6f7
address
tb1p3pypcmv33j4n828hu40xg7fl8e3nl8z23a8fd5rjcmpgatxf5mmsu5wr8n
transaction
c3fab11072155359f7fd77ee70c8317550727613c6246070c3467333f60f5e33
spent
true